An ideal 500 MW steam power plant operates with an ideal Rankine
cycle. Steam leaves the boiler and enters the turbine at 2 MPa and
500 C. The condenser pressure is 10 kPa. (a) mass steam flow, kg/s
(b)turbine output, kW (c) pump work required, kW (d) heatrejected
in the condenser, kJ/s (e) heat added in the boiler, kJ/s (f)
amount of cooling water needed in the condenser if cooling water
temperature increased by 15°C, m³/s and GPM (g) thermal efficiency
of the cycle, %(35%)
